在当今数据驱动的商业环境中,企业越来越依赖于数据分析和预测技术来优化决策、提高效率并创造价值。基于机器学习的指标预测分析技术作为一种强大的工具,正在被广泛应用于各个行业。本文将深入探讨这一技术的实现细节,帮助企业更好地理解和应用这一技术。
1. 什么是指标预测分析?
指标预测分析是一种通过历史数据和机器学习算法,预测未来某个关键指标(如销售额、设备故障率、客户流失率等)的技术。它可以帮助企业提前了解未来的业务趋势,从而做出更明智的决策。
2. 机器学习在指标预测中的作用
机器学习通过从大量数据中提取模式和关系,能够自动构建预测模型。与传统的统计方法相比,机器学习具有更高的灵活性和准确性,尤其是在处理非线性关系和高维数据时表现尤为突出。
3. 常见的应用场景
1. 数据预处理
数据预处理是机器学习模型构建的关键步骤,主要包括以下几个方面:
2. 模型选择与训练
根据业务需求和数据特征,选择合适的机器学习算法。常见的算法包括:
3. 模型调参与优化
通过交叉验证和网格搜索等方法,优化模型的超参数,以提高预测精度。例如,在训练LSTM模型时,可以调整学习率、层数和隐藏层大小。
4. 模型部署与监控
将训练好的模型部署到生产环境中,并通过自动化工具实时监控模型的性能。如果发现模型性能下降,需要及时重新训练或更新模型。
1. 数据预处理的详细步骤
StandardScaler
或MinMaxScaler
。2. 模型选择的考虑因素
3. 模型部署的实现方式
1. 销售预测案例
某零售企业希望通过预测未来的销售额来优化库存管理。通过收集过去几年的销售数据、季节性数据和促销活动数据,使用LSTM模型进行预测。最终,模型预测的准确率达到95%,帮助企业显著降低了库存成本。
2. 设备维护案例
某制造企业使用传感器数据预测设备的故障时间。通过训练随机森林模型,企业能够提前发现潜在故障,避免了设备停机带来的损失。
3. 金融风险评估案例
某银行希望通过预测客户违约概率来优化信贷决策。通过收集客户的信用历史、收入和消费记录,使用XGBoost模型进行预测。最终,模型的准确率达到85%,显著提高了银行的风险控制能力。
1. 数据质量的挑战
2. 模型解释性的挑战
3. 计算资源的挑战
自动化机器学习(AutoML):通过自动化工具(如AutoML平台)降低机器学习的门槛,使更多企业能够轻松应用这一技术。
边缘计算与物联网:随着物联网技术的发展,未来的指标预测分析将更多地在边缘计算环境中进行,以减少数据传输延迟。
强化学习的应用:强化学习将在动态环境中的预测分析中发挥越来越重要的作用,例如金融交易和游戏AI。
基于机器学习的指标预测分析技术为企业提供了强大的数据驱动决策能力。通过合理选择和优化模型,企业可以显著提升预测精度并创造更大的价值。然而,这一技术的实现需要结合企业的实际需求和数据特点,同时还需要关注数据质量和模型解释性等挑战。
未来,随着技术的不断发展,指标预测分析将更加智能化和自动化,为企业创造更大的价值。如果您希望了解更多信息或申请试用相关技术,请访问 DTStack。
(图1:数据预处理流程)
(图2:机器学习模型训练与部署流程)
(图3:指标预测分析的应用场景示意图)
申请试用&下载资料